a car is moving down the street at 55km/h. a child suddenly runs into the street. If it takes the driver 0.75 seconds to react and apply the brakes, how many METERS will the car have moved before it begins to slow down: Please show work on how you got the answer

Sagot :

11.46 meters

55 km/h = ? m/s
55 km/h × 1000 (meters per km) = 55,000 m/h
55,000 m/h ÷ 3,600 (seconds in an hour) = 15.28 m/s
15.28 m/s × 0.75 s = 11.46 m
